PDP Minority Leader Talks Underway to Bring Peter Obi and Goodluck Jonathan Back for 2027 Presidential Race

Senate Minority Leader and senior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) member Abba Moro has revealed ongoing talks aimed at bringing former presidential candidate Peter Obi and ex-President Goodluck Jonathan back to the PDP fold to contest the 2027 presidential election.

Speaking on Channels Television’s “Politics Today,” Moro disclosed that certain individuals are engaging with Obi, encouraging him to “come back home” to PDPwhere he could have a strong chance at securing the party’s presidential ticket.

Moro acknowledged the unpredictability of politics but affirmed that efforts are underway to unite the figures within the party’s framework.

Regarding Jonathan, the former president, Moro confirmed that conversations are ongoing about his potential return and presidential bid, though constitutional concerns and political opposition continue to surface.

Moro cited the precedent from Jonathan’s 2015 run which faced legal challenges but was eventually upheld.

Moro further stated that PDP plans a careful evaluation of all aspirants, including current interested candidates like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de to field a strong contender capable of challenging the incumbent All Progressives Congress (APC).

The remarks come amid PDP’s strategic preparations following what Moro described as errors in the 2023 elections showing the opposition party’s determination to reclaim influence in 2027.
